
R33
| Max pressure | 350 Bar |
| Temp range | -45°C~200°C |
| Max speed | 15m/sec |
The R33 is a double-acting low-friction rod seal solution for compact o-ring grooves, that extends the service range above what an o-ring alone is capable of supporting. The R33 is designed for light-duty applications, is particularly suited for small-diameter installations, and due to its size and design, is easy to install. High-performance materials, like HLX, provide outstanding wear and extrusion resistance properties as well as large range of temperature and media compatibility.
The R33 is designed to be used in existing dynamic o-ring grooves and does not require any groove modification. A good choice for pneumatic and hydraulic equipment sealing needs.
Small‑diameter rod sealing (core application): Specially designed for small‑diameter cylinders (from 4mm), ideal for mini cylinders, small pneumatic cylinders, precision instruments, and small hydraulic valves with extremely limited space.
Compact O‑ring groove upgrade replacement: Fits directly into existing dynamic O‑ring grooves without modification; delivers far superior sealing and service life than standalone O‑rings; perfect for quick upgrades of standard equipment.
Light‑duty hydraulic & pneumatic equipment: Designed for light‑duty applications, suitable for both hydraulic and pneumatic systems; widely used in automation, small fixtures, electronics, medical devices, and precision actuators.
Medium‑pressure high‑speed reciprocating mechanisms: Rated up to 350bar with max speed 15m/s; low friction, no stick‑slip; ideal for high‑speed small servos, high‑speed valves, and mini cylinders.
Wide‑temperature & multi‑fluid environments: Operates from -45°C to 200°C; compatible with mineral oils, synthetic esters, water‑based fluids; not suitable for phosphate esters; fits cold, hot, and multi‑fluid conditions.
Extremely space‑limited installations: Ultra‑compact, easy installation; perfect for miniaturized, integrated hydraulic/pneumatic components like small robots, portable devices, precision instruments, and small power units.
Long‑life low‑maintenance equipment: Excellent wear & extrusion resistance; longer life and less maintenance than standard O‑rings; for continuous‑running small automation lines, precision equipment, and outdoor small units.
